 I filed my state tax return and owed $64 but there never was a prompt for me to enter a debit/credit card to pay. The return was accepted by the state.  My state is Virginia.

Not all states have the option to pay that way. However, reading the website for VA taxes, it's really not all that clear to me if you can do it your way. I get the impression you can. But having only perused the page, it's not clear for me. However, to reduce late payment fees you can just go to <a rel="nofollow" target="_blank" href="https://tax.virginia.gov/payments">https://tax.virginia.gov/payments</a> and make your 2018 tax payment there.

First, make sure the state  E-File was accepted:

https://turbotax.intuit.com/tax-tools/efile-status-lookup/

_________________________

Then, if Accepted, Get your tax file PDF and look the State "Electronic Filing Instructions"

IF...if, you arranged the payment with your e-file, those worksheets will look like the following picture.....check the date and account numbers too.

__________________________

IF you don't see that the payment as arranged with your e-file...you can pay VA directly here:

https://tax.virginia.gov/individual-income-tax-payment-options
